Dual Enrollment courses allow high school students to earn credit toward their high school diploma and college credit simultaneously. The Danville Public Schools Child Nutrition Department participates in the National School Lunch and Breakfast Programs, which are federally administered by the U. Cell Phone Policy - Danville Public SchoolsRecognizing the mental health effects on children and the impact student’s dependence on cell phones and smart devices are having in our schools, Governor Glenn Youngkin signed into law a bipartisan act of the Virginia General Assembly to help bring a cell phone and smart device free education to Virginia’s schools. Dual enrollment courses are taught at the high school and offer college credit through agreements with Danville Community College. RFPs will be posted on the DPS website. T.
